Stop smoking! How to quit smoking cigarettes


Well, the first thing to do is... just do it. Stop smoking. Hopefully, it will work. If it doesn't work, it's not a failure: It's just the beginning of the journey. You see, changing habits that are as ingrained as smoking is a complex process.

Smoking is not just about the taste of cigarettes, or the physical need for nicotine. There's a whole lot of other things connected to this habit. For instance, the gestures and the rituals associated with smoking (see how fidgety you get when you stop having a cigarette to hold on to). or, smoking may have been helping you deal with feeling nervous, or tense.

So quitting is not just about cigarettes. It is also about all the other stuff that is related to how and why you smoke. This is why it is often more productive to think of the process of quitting as a journey of self-discovery.
